Hgfu Ransomware Will Lock Your Files

While examining malicious software samples, we came across the Hgfu ransomware, which is part of the Djvu malware family. Once it infiltrates a computer, this ransomware encrypts files and appends the ".hgfu" extension to their names. To illustrate, a file initially called "1.jpg" becomes "1.jpg.hgfu," and "2.png" transforms into "2.png.hgfu," and so forth.

In addition to file encryption, Hgfu creates a ransom message in the form of a text file titled "_readme.txt." The distribution of Hgfu may involve information-stealing malware like Vidar and RedLine. Cybercriminals often employ these types of malware to gather sensitive data before using Djvu ransomware to lock files.

The ransom note emphasizes that unlocking the encrypted files depends entirely on specialized decryption software and a unique decryption key. It offers instructions to victims, directing them to contact the attackers via the given email addresses (support@freshmail.top or datarestorehelp@airmail.cc) for further guidance.

Furthermore, the ransom note presents two different ransom amounts, specifically $980 and $490, suggesting that victims might qualify for a discount on the decryption tools if they reach out to the attackers within a 72-hour window.

Hgfu Ransom Note Raises Ransom in Three Days

The full text of the Hgfu ransom note reads as follows:

ATTENTION!

Don't worry, you can return all your files!
All your files like pictures, databases, documents and other important are encrypted with strongest encryption and unique key.
The only method of recovering files is to purchase decrypt tool and unique key for you.
This software will decrypt all your encrypted files.
What guarantees you have?
You can send one of your encrypted file from your PC and we decrypt it for free.
But we can decrypt only 1 file for free. File must not contain valuable information.
You can get and look video overview decrypt tool:
hxxps://we.tl/t-iTbDHY13BX
Price of private key and decrypt software is $980.
Discount 50% available if you contact us first 72 hours, that's price for you is $490.
Please note that you'll never restore your data without payment.
Check your e-mail "Spam" or "Junk" folder if you don't get answer more than 6 hours.

To get this software you need write on our e-mail:
support@freshmail.top

Reserve e-mail address to contact us:
datarestorehelp@airmail.cc

How Can Ransomware Like Hgfu Enter Your System?

Ransomware like Hgfu can enter your system through various methods, and it's essential to be aware of these entry points to protect your computer. Here are common ways ransomware can infiltrate a system:

  • Phishing Emails: One of the most prevalent methods is through phishing emails. Cybercriminals send emails that appear legitimate, often with malicious attachments or links. When you open these attachments or click on the links, it can execute the ransomware on your computer.
  • Malicious Websites: Visiting compromised or malicious websites can also expose your system to ransomware. Drive-by downloads occur when malware is automatically downloaded and installed without your knowledge or consent when you visit a compromised website.
  • Infected Downloads: Downloading software or files from untrustworthy sources, especially cracked software or pirated content, can introduce ransomware onto your system. Always download from reputable sources.
  • Removable Media: Ransomware can spread through infected USB drives, external hard drives, or other removable media. If you connect an infected device to your computer, the ransomware may propagate.
  • Malvertising: Malicious advertising, or malvertising, involves cybercriminals placing infected ads on legitimate websites. Clicking on these ads can lead to ransomware infections.
  • Social Engineering: Attackers may use social engineering techniques to trick you into running malicious code. For example, they might impersonate technical support personnel or colleagues and ask you to run a file or perform a specific action that installs ransomware.
  • Malicious Macros: Some ransomware strains are distributed via infected macros in Microsoft Office documents. Enabling macros in a malicious document can trigger the ransomware installation.
